🔑 Вспомнить забытый пароль WordPress: пошаговая инструкция восстановления доступа

🔑 Вспомнить забытый пароль WordPress: пошаговая инструкция восстановления доступа

Забыли пароль от своей учетной записи WordPress? Не паникуйте! Это случается с каждым. К счастью, существует несколько способов восстановить доступ к вашей панели управления. В этой статье мы подробно рассмотрим все возможные методы, начиная с самых простых и заканчивая более сложными, требующими доступа к базе данных или файлам вашего сайта.

Содержание

  1. Восстановление пароля через форму восстановления WordPress (самый простой способ)
  2. Восстановление пароля через электронную почту (если не приходит письмо)
  3. Восстановление пароля через phpMyAdmin (доступ к базе данных)
  4. Восстановление пароля через functions.php (временный администратор)
  5. Восстановление пароля через командную строку WP-CLI (для продвинутых пользователей)
  6. Предотвращение проблем с паролями в будущем
  7. Дополнительные советы и рекомендации

1. Восстановление пароля через форму восстановления WordPress

Это самый простой и распространенный способ восстановления доступа. Если вы помните свой логин или адрес электронной почты, связанный с вашей учетной записью WordPress, то этот метод для вас.

**Шаги:**

  1. Перейдите на страницу входа в WordPress (обычно это `вашсайт.com/wp-login.php` или `вашсайт.com/wp-admin`).
  2. Нажмите на ссылку «Забыли пароль?» (или «Lost your password?»).
  3. Введите ваш логин или адрес электронной почты, связанный с вашей учетной записью.
  4. Нажмите кнопку «Получить новый пароль» (или «Get New Password»).
  5. Проверьте свой почтовый ящик. Вы должны получить письмо с инструкциями по сбросу пароля. Обязательно проверьте папку «Спам» или «Нежелательная почта», так как письмо может попасть туда.
  6. Перейдите по ссылке в письме. Она перенаправит вас на страницу, где вы сможете ввести новый пароль.
  7. Введите новый пароль. Рекомендуется использовать сложный пароль, состоящий из букв верхнего и нижнего регистра, цифр и специальных символов.
  8. Подтвердите новый пароль.
  9. Нажмите кнопку «Сохранить пароль» (или «Reset Password»).

**Что делать, если вы не получили письмо?**

* **Проверьте папку «Спам»/«Нежелательная почта»:** Письма от WordPress иногда попадают в эти папки.
* **Убедитесь, что вы ввели правильный адрес электронной почты или логин:** Даже небольшая ошибка может привести к тому, что письмо не будет отправлено.
* **Проверьте настройки электронной почты на вашем хостинге:** Возможно, есть проблемы с отправкой электронной почты с вашего сервера. Обратитесь в службу поддержки вашего хостинга для проверки.
* **Попробуйте другой адрес электронной почты:** Если у вас есть несколько адресов электронной почты, связанных с вашим сайтом, попробуйте восстановить пароль с использованием каждого из них.
* **Используйте альтернативные методы восстановления пароля:** Если этот способ не работает, переходите к следующим разделам этой статьи.

2. Восстановление пароля через электронную почту (если не приходит письмо)

Если вы не получили письмо для сброса пароля, несмотря на то, что проверили папку «Спам» и убедились в правильности введенного адреса электронной почты, возможно, проблема связана с настройками вашего почтового сервера или с тем, как WordPress настроен для отправки электронных писем.

**Возможные причины и решения:**

* **Проблемы с SMTP-сервером:** WordPress по умолчанию использует функцию PHP `mail()` для отправки электронных писем. Многие хостинг-провайдеры ограничивают или блокируют эту функцию из-за спама. Решение: настройте WordPress для использования SMTP-сервера. Это более надежный способ отправки электронных писем.
* **Установите плагин SMTP:** Существует множество плагинов WordPress, которые позволяют легко настроить SMTP. Наиболее популярные: WP Mail SMTP, Easy WP SMTP, Post SMTP Mailer/Email Log. Установите и активируйте один из этих плагинов.
* **Настройте плагин:** В настройках плагина укажите данные вашего SMTP-сервера: адрес сервера, порт, имя пользователя и пароль. Эти данные можно получить у вашего хостинг-провайдера или использовать данные от вашего почтового сервиса (например, Gmail, Yandex.Mail и т.д.).
* **Протестируйте отправку письма:** Плагин обычно предоставляет возможность протестировать отправку письма, чтобы убедиться, что настройки верны.
* **Плагин блокирует отправку писем:** Некоторые плагины безопасности или кэширования могут блокировать отправку электронных писем. Отключите эти плагины по одному и попробуйте восстановить пароль еще раз.
* **Проблемы с DNS:** Неправильные настройки DNS могут влиять на доставку электронных писем. Убедитесь, что у вас правильно настроены записи MX для вашего домена.
* **Обратитесь в службу поддержки хостинга:** Если вы не можете решить проблему самостоятельно, обратитесь в службу поддержки вашего хостинга. Они могут помочь вам определить причину, по которой письма не доходят, и предложить решение.

3. Восстановление пароля через phpMyAdmin

Этот способ требует доступа к базе данных вашего сайта WordPress через phpMyAdmin (или аналогичный инструмент управления базами данных, предоставляемый вашим хостинг-провайдером). Он более сложный, чем предыдущие, но может быть полезен, если другие методы не работают.

**Шаги:**

  1. **Войдите в панель управления своим хостинг-провайдером.**
  2. **Найдите раздел «phpMyAdmin» (или аналогичный инструмент) и откройте его.** Название раздела может варьироваться в зависимости от хостинг-провайдера. Обычно он находится в разделе «Базы данных» или «Управление базами данных».
  3. **Выберите базу данных, связанную с вашим сайтом WordPress.** Если у вас несколько баз данных, убедитесь, что выбрали правильную. Имя базы данных можно найти в файле `wp-config.php` вашего сайта (см. раздел «Восстановление пароля через functions.php», чтобы узнать, как получить доступ к файлам сайта).
  4. **Найдите таблицу `wp_users`.** Префикс `wp_` может отличаться в зависимости от настроек вашего сайта. Если префикс другой, найдите таблицу с названием, заканчивающимся на `_users`.
  5. **Найдите в таблице свою учетную запись пользователя.** Обычно это делается по вашему имени пользователя или адресу электронной почты.
  6. **Нажмите кнопку «Редактировать» (или «Edit») напротив своей учетной записи.**
  7. **Найдите поле `user_pass`.** Это поле содержит зашифрованный пароль.
  8. **В поле «Функция» (или «Function») выберите `MD5`.** Это алгоритм хеширования, который WordPress использует для хранения паролей.
  9. **В поле «Значение» (или «Value») введите новый пароль.** Не забудьте, что пароль будет зашифрован, поэтому вы вводите его как обычный текст.
  10. **Нажмите кнопку «Выполнить» (или «Go») внизу страницы.**

**Важно!**

* **Будьте осторожны при работе с базой данных.** Неправильные изменения могут привести к повреждению вашего сайта.
* **Сохраните резервную копию базы данных перед внесением изменений.** Это позволит вам восстановить сайт в случае возникновения проблем.
* **После изменения пароля через phpMyAdmin, войдите в свою учетную запись WordPress с новым паролем.**

4. Восстановление пароля через functions.php (временный администратор)

Этот метод позволяет создать временную учетную запись администратора, с помощью которой вы сможете войти в WordPress и изменить пароль своей основной учетной записи. Он требует доступа к файлам вашего сайта, обычно через FTP или файловый менеджер, предоставляемый вашим хостинг-провайдером.

**Шаги:**

  1. **Войдите в панель управления своим хостинг-провайдером.**
  2. **Найдите раздел «Файловый менеджер» (или «FTP»).** Название раздела может варьироваться в зависимости от хостинг-провайдера.
  3. **Перейдите в папку, где установлен ваш WordPress.** Обычно это папка `public_html` или `www`.
  4. **Найдите папку `wp-content` и откройте ее.**
  5. **Найдите папку `themes` и откройте ее.**
  6. **Найдите папку с названием активной темы вашего сайта.** Если вы не знаете, какая тема активна, попробуйте изменить файл `functions.php` для каждой темы по очереди, пока не получится войти в систему.
  7. **Найдите файл `functions.php` и откройте его для редактирования.** Обычно это можно сделать, нажав правой кнопкой мыши на файл и выбрав опцию «Редактировать» (или «Edit»).
  8. **Добавьте следующий код в самый верх файла `functions.php`, сразу после открывающего тега `set_role( ‘administrator’ );
    }
    }
    add_action(‘init’,’create_temporary_admin’);

    **Важно!** Замените `temporaryadmin`, `temporarypassword` и `[email protected]` на свои значения. Используйте сложный пароль для временной учетной записи.

  9. **Сохраните файл `functions.php`.**
  10. **Перейдите на страницу входа в WordPress и войдите под временной учетной записью (`temporaryadmin` и `temporarypassword` в примере выше).**
  11. **Перейдите в раздел «Пользователи» (или «Users») и найдите свою основную учетную запись.**
  12. **Отредактируйте свою основную учетную запись и измените пароль.**
  13. **После изменения пароля, удалите добавленный код из файла `functions.php`.** Это очень важно, чтобы временная учетная запись не осталась активной.
  14. **Войдите в свою основную учетную запись WordPress с новым паролем.**

**Важно!**

* **После выполнения всех шагов обязательно удалите код из файла `functions.php`.** Оставленный код представляет угрозу безопасности вашего сайта.
* **Используйте этот метод только в крайнем случае, когда другие методы не работают.**
* **Будьте внимательны при редактировании файлов сайта.** Неправильные изменения могут привести к повреждению вашего сайта.

5. Восстановление пароля через командную строку WP-CLI

Этот метод предназначен для продвинутых пользователей, которые имеют доступ к командной строке (терминалу) на своем сервере и знакомы с WP-CLI (WordPress Command Line Interface).

**Что такое WP-CLI?**

WP-CLI – это инструмент командной строки для управления WordPress. Он позволяет выполнять различные задачи, такие как установка плагинов, тем, обновление WordPress, управление пользователями и многое другое, без использования веб-интерфейса.

**Требования:**

* Доступ к командной строке (терминалу) на вашем сервере.
* Установленный и настроенный WP-CLI.
* Знание основных команд WP-CLI.

**Шаги:**

  1. **Подключитесь к командной строке (терминалу) на своем сервере.** Это можно сделать через SSH или через панель управления вашего хостинг-провайдера.
  2. **Перейдите в корневую директорию вашего сайта WordPress.** Используйте команду `cd` для навигации по файловой системе. Например, `cd /var/www/вашсайт.com/public_html`.
  3. **Выполните команду для изменения пароля пользователя:**

    bash
    wp user update имя_пользователя –user_pass=’новый_пароль’

    Замените `имя_пользователя` на имя пользователя, пароль которого вы хотите изменить, и `новый_пароль` на новый пароль. Рекомендуется использовать сложный пароль.

  4. **Убедитесь, что команда выполнилась успешно.** WP-CLI должен вывести сообщение об успешном обновлении пользователя.
  5. **Войдите в свою учетную запись WordPress с новым паролем.**

**Пример:**

bash
wp user update admin –user_pass=’StrongPassword123!’

Эта команда изменит пароль пользователя `admin` на `StrongPassword123!`.

**Дополнительные команды WP-CLI, которые могут быть полезны:**

* **`wp user list`:** Выводит список всех пользователей WordPress.
* **`wp user get имя_пользователя`:** Выводит информацию о конкретном пользователе.

**Важно!**

* **Будьте осторожны при работе с командной строкой.** Неправильные команды могут привести к повреждению вашего сайта.
* **Убедитесь, что вы правильно вводите имя пользователя и новый пароль.**
* **Используйте этот метод, только если вы уверены в своих знаниях и навыках.**

6. Предотвращение проблем с паролями в будущем

Чтобы избежать проблем с забытыми паролями в будущем, рекомендуется предпринять следующие меры:

* **Используйте сложные и уникальные пароли.** Избегайте использования простых паролей, таких как даты рождения, имена домашних животных или распространенные слова. Используйте комбинацию букв верхнего и нижнего регистра, цифр и специальных символов.
* **Используйте менеджер паролей.** Менеджеры паролей, такие как LastPass, 1Password или Bitwarden, позволяют безопасно хранить и генерировать сложные пароли для всех ваших учетных записей. Они автоматически заполняют пароли на веб-сайтах и в приложениях, что упрощает использование сложных паролей без необходимости их запоминать.
* **Регулярно обновляйте свои пароли.** Регулярная смена паролей повышает безопасность ваших учетных записей. Рекомендуется менять пароли каждые 3-6 месяцев.
* **Держите свою контактную информацию в актуальном состоянии.** Убедитесь, что адрес электронной почты, связанный с вашей учетной записью WordPress, актуален и к нему есть доступ. Это необходимо для восстановления пароля в случае его забывания.
* **Включите двухфакторную аутентификацию (2FA).** 2FA добавляет дополнительный уровень безопасности к вашей учетной записи. При входе в систему вам потребуется ввести не только пароль, но и код, сгенерированный приложением на вашем смартфоне. Это значительно усложняет взлом вашей учетной записи, даже если злоумышленник узнает ваш пароль.
* **Запишите свой пароль в надежном месте.** Если вы не используете менеджер паролей, запишите свой пароль на бумаге и храните ее в безопасном месте. Не храните пароли в текстовых файлах на своем компьютере или в облачных сервисах, если они не зашифрованы.

7. Дополнительные советы и рекомендации

* **Обратитесь в службу поддержки вашего хостинг-провайдера.** Если ни один из вышеперечисленных методов не помог вам восстановить доступ к вашей учетной записи WordPress, обратитесь в службу поддержки вашего хостинг-провайдера. Они могут предложить дополнительные решения или помочь вам восстановить доступ к вашему сайту.
* **Рассмотрите возможность найма специалиста WordPress.** Если вы не уверены в своих силах или не хотите тратить время на восстановление пароля, вы можете нанять специалиста WordPress, который поможет вам решить эту проблему.
* **Создавайте резервные копии своего сайта.** Регулярное создание резервных копий вашего сайта позволяет вам восстановить его в случае возникновения проблем, включая потерю доступа к учетной записи администратора.
* **Будьте бдительны и осторожны.** Не переходите по подозрительным ссылкам и не вводите свои данные на сомнительных сайтах. Это поможет вам избежать фишинга и других киберугроз.

В заключение, восстановление забытого пароля WordPress может быть немного сложным, но с помощью этой подробной инструкции вы сможете восстановить доступ к своей учетной записи. Помните, что самый простой способ – это форма восстановления пароля WordPress, но если это не работает, то другие методы, описанные в этой статье, помогут вам решить проблему. Не забывайте о мерах предосторожности и используйте сложные пароли, чтобы избежать подобных проблем в будущем. Удачи!

0 0 votes
Article Rating
Subscribe
Notify of
0 Comments
Oldest
Newest Most Voted
Inline Feedbacks
View all comments